NBA: New Orleans 105, Denver 101

DENVER, Nov. 28 (UPI) -- James Posey's three-pointer with 19.1 seconds left followed by four Hornets free throws Thursday gave New Orleans a 105-101 win over the Denver Nuggets.

The Hornets got their fourth straight win with the help of Chris Paul's 22 points and 10 assists. Rasual Butler added 19 points and Peja Stojakovic 17.

The Nuggets were led by J.R. Smith's game-high 32 points, five rebounds and four assists. Carmelo Anthony chipped in 24 points and Chauncey Billings had 12.

Denver, which lost for the second time in eight games, trailed 32-22 after the first quarter but eventually pulled into a 98-98 tie with 37.6 seconds left only to fade away from there.
